Output 425544539efda13f10cd514b3b2d6d6f75a78fa7498a990224de37a1640943a8:6

value
377530
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 310efce707ff3836e8c6b25fbfda63cfd6a0e9ee OP_EQUALVERIFY OP_CHECKSIG
address
15UQ4n5hAbzVG1M38nKj3PbkPftJRygVUG
transaction
425544539efda13f10cd514b3b2d6d6f75a78fa7498a990224de37a1640943a8
spent
true